I set it on smoke setting and it ran about 180 for about 5 hrs kicked it up to 220 for a few hrs then 250 the remainder til i hit 205 in the point, this brisket weighed over 17lbs with very little fat that I trimmed off, was worried about lack of but turned out perfect, used lumber jack hickory pellets and my pitboss Austin lx pellet smoker
